Output 77bf31715a28ef36c48970a81d6a85411daf1224124b9491820cbead4272256e:0

value
354660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ded3fce0deffa0c08b970233434ccc7e3f2a29fd OP_EQUAL
address
3N1DtJRAz72K1mXxg4v1KBwQkBqHDRzfEf
transaction
77bf31715a28ef36c48970a81d6a85411daf1224124b9491820cbead4272256e
spent
true